AlertifyMe Mobile - Share what's happening right now and around you from where you stand.
With AlertifyMe Mobile you can share what is happening at your current location with your friends right from your device. You can share a picture or a short message tagged to your location.
You can even notify your friends that there is something interesting happening at your place by tagging them to an alert.
In addition to social alerting, we have AlertifyMe Points. You will earn points while using AlertifyMe. You can redeem these points for something surprising that we will introduce later. ;)
